KAMCO - Athani

When mechanization of agricultural farms commenced in the country, heavy duty tractors were extensively used. However, with the land reforms coming into force in the 60s, extent of land holding also came down, which resulted in the usage of heavy duty Tractors becoming expensive per plot. For land preparation before sowing or transplanting of small plot, it was necessary to have a small machine, which can be operated by the farmer himself. An answer to such requirements was the Power Tiller.

Kerala Agro Machinery Corporation Ltd., a Government of Kerala Undertaking was formed with the intention of manufacturing Power Tiller operated by Diesel Engine. The company came into existence in Athani in Ernakulam District in 1973 when it started assembling Power Tillers under Technical Collaboration from M/s. Kubota Ltd., Japan. The product is now made in India and is suitably designed to meet the Indian conditions. There are more than 1.5 lakh of KAMCO Power Tillers operating in various States in India.

Transport Corporation of India Ltd. has been associated with KAMCO for about 25 years and transports material to all parts of the country. The machines have to move direct to the concerned destinations in the same truck. It is here that TCI plays a major role in the movement of the machine and also ensures availability of spare parts with all the dealers. An endorsement of excellent service from TCI has come by way of certificate of appreciation from KAMCO. KAMCO Kubota Combine Harvester and KAMCO Kukje Paddy Transplanter are the latest introduction in the country from KAMCO. The Transplanter takes away the burden of dreary manual labour of transplanting the seedlings thus taking away the human fatigue in the transplanting operation.

KAMCO has got 4 Assembling Units located at Athani and Kalamassery in Ernakulam District, Kanjikoade in Palakkad District and Mala in Thrissur District of Kerala State. Provides direct employment to approx. 600 persons in its various units.
